Special Council Meeting <br />5:30 P.M. <br /> May 19, 1981 <br /> <br />Members Present: <br /> <br />Mayor Gamec <br />Councilmember Van Wagner <br />Councilmember Sorteberg <br />Councilmember Reimann <br />Councilmember Cox <br /> <br />~lso Present: <br /> <br />Mr. Richard Sha, Consmlting Engineer <br />Mr. William Goodrich, City Attorney <br />Mr. Clayton R. Berg, Building Official <br /> <br />Mr. Goodrich stated that the purpose of the meeting was to discuss the <br />current situation of the landfill as well as to advise the City Council <br />as to how the City should proceed with this matter. He further stated <br />the meeting would be conducted under regulations allowing for a closed <br />meeting based on attorney/client rights inasmuch as they would be dis- <br />cussing the lawsuit against the City of Anoka. <br /> <br />A discussion among Council members followed in regards to Councilmember <br />Van Wagner's involvement in landfill issues inasmuch as she currently <br />resides adjacent to the landfill. <br /> <br />The Council concensus was that she would probably have to determiue her- <br />self what she felt may constitute a conflict of interest. <br /> <br />Mayor Gamec announced that the methane extraction flaring wottld take <br />place at 7:30 A.M., Wednesday, May 20, 1981. Council discussion on <br />this matter followed. <br /> <br />City Attorney Goodrich explained to the City Council the current status <br />of the landfill issue. A lengthy discussion by the City Council followed. <br /> <br />Mr. Sha presented the City Council with a proposal.he felt they should <br />consider. Another lengthy discussion regarding his recommendation followed. <br /> <br />City Attorney Goodrich asked the City Council for direction. It was their <br />concensus that he proceed as he had been previously directed and report <br />back to them at a special meeting which is set for 6:30 P.M., Tuesday, <br />May 26, 1981. <br /> <br />Respectfully submitted, <br /> <br />Lloyd G. Schnelle <br />City Administrator/Clerk <br /> <br /> <br />
